## Account Recovery — GateTally Counter

If an operator at Pellow Stadium gets locked out of the GateTally turnstile counter, verify their shift roster entry first, then reset via the ops panel. If the panel itself is locked, you'll need the recovery passphrase, which is kept on file right below this paragraph.

unlock words, hahip-baduf: holwyn-istath-julvan

Ticket #—: Vault locked, blocking contrast audit

Hey, welcome to the Bramblehook team! The Tintfold vault with our color-contrast audit reports locked itself again, so you can't pull last sprint's findings yet. Annoying, I know. To get back in, open the vault prompt and enter the recovery passphrase below.

vault phrase of bagaf-kajeg = jorath-feniel-briir-siliel-ralix

UserSplit Cutover Drift: the extracted account service and the legacy Marigold monolith user module are reporting divergent record counts during dual-write. This fires when drift exceeds 0.5% over 15 minutes. New team members should not replay writes manually. Reconciliation steps and the rollback procedure are documented on the internal page.

wiki page, tajog-fafog: https://gitlab.paliqsys.corp/dash/display/job/853dd6fcbf54